导航方法及装置制造方法

文档序号:6169882阅读:188来源:国知局
导航方法及装置制造方法
【专利摘要】一种导航方法,包括:获取输入的关键字;获取地图信息,根据所述关键字和所述地图信息获取目标位置;跟踪获取定位信息;根据所述目标位置、定位信息以及所述地图信息生成导航信息;通过语音播报所述导航信息。此外,还提供了一种导航装置。上述导航方法及装置能够提高安全性。
【专利说明】导航方法及装置

【技术领域】
[0001] 本发明涉及定位导航【技术领域】,特别是涉及一种导航方法及装置。

【背景技术】
[0002] 现有技术的手机导航装置或车载导航装置,通常存储有离线地图,并根据用户在 地图搜索栏的输入框中输入的目标位置建立到该目标位置的导航信息,并展示在地图上。
[0003] 然而,发明人经分析发现现有技术中的导航装置至少存在以下问题:
[0004] 现有技术中的导航装置展示导航信息的方式为通过显示屏上的指示图标进行展 示,因此需要驾驶者通过导航装置的显示屏获取导航信息,使得驾驶者在驾驶时存在安全 风险,导致安全性较低。


【发明内容】

[0005] 基于此,有必要提供一种能提高安全性的导航方法。
[0006] 一种导航方法,包括:
[0007] 获取输入的关键字;
[0008] 获取地图信息,根据所述关键字和所述地图信息获取目标位置;
[0009] 跟踪获取定位信息;
[0010] 根据所述目标位置、定位信息以及所述地图信息生成导航信息;
[0011] 通过语音播报所述导航信息。
[0012] 此外,还有必要提供一种能提高安全性的导航装置。
[0013] 一种导航装置,包括:
[0014] 关键字获取模块,用于获取输入的关键字;
[0015] 目标位置获取模块,用于获取地图信息,根据所述关键字和所述地图信息获取目 标位置;
[0016] 跟踪定位模块,用于跟踪获取定位信息;
[0017] 导航信息生成模块,用于根据所述目标位置、定位信息以及所述地图信息生成导 航信息;
[0018] 语音播报模块,用于通过语音播报所述导航信息。
[0019] 上述导航方法及装置,通过语音播报导航信息,使得用户在驾驶时无需专注于显 示屏上的行驶路线,而将注意力放在驾驶视野上,从而避免了因驾驶者注意力不集中导致 的车祸,提高了安全性。

【专利附图】

【附图说明】
[0020] 图1为一个实施例中导航方法的流程图;
[0021] 图2为一个实施例中导航装置的结构示意图;
[0022] 图3为另一个实施例中导航装置的结构示意图。

【具体实施方式】
[0023] 在一个实施例中,如图1所示,一种导航方法,该方法完全依赖于计算机程序,该 计算机程序可运行于基于冯洛伊曼体系的计算机系统上,例如车载导航装置、手持导航定 位仪、智能手机、平板电脑以及掌上电脑等。该方法包括以下步骤:
[0024] 步骤S102,获取输入的关键字。
[0025] 步骤S104,获取地图信息,根据关键字和地图信息获取目标位置。
[0026] 在一个实施例中,可获取文本输入框中输入的关键字,并在获取到的地图信息中 进行搜索,查找与关键字对应的兴趣点名称,并获取兴趣点名称的位置信息作为目标位置。 在导航【技术领域】中,兴趣点即电子地图上标记餐饮、公交、地铁、写字楼、商场等实体设施的 标识。例如,若用户输入的关键字为"腾讯",则与之相应的兴趣点名称可以是"腾讯大厦", 其对应的位置信息即为腾讯公司办公楼所在的具体位置。在本实施例中,若与关键字对应 的兴趣点名称有多个,可将与关键字对应的多个兴趣点以列表的形式展示,并获取输入的 兴趣点选取请求,获取兴趣点选取请求对应的兴趣点名称。
[0027] 在一个实施例中,还可获取输入的音频片段,对音频片段进行语音识别得到关键 字。
[0028] 在本实施例中,用户可通过话筒口述其希望到达的目的地的名称。在获取到该用 户口述的音频片段后,对其进行音频识别,得到对应的字符串,并将其作为关键字在地图信 息中进行查找,得到对应的兴趣点名称,并获取其对应的位置信息。若查找到的兴趣点名称 有多个,可通过语音播报该多个兴趣点名称,并获取用户口述的选择指令,通过对该选择指 令进行语音识别,得到用户选取的兴趣点名称,从而获取到兴趣点名称对应的位置信息作 为目标位置。
[0029] 步骤S106,跟踪定位信息。
[0030] 定位信息即使用导航装置的用户实际所在的地理位置信息。可通过定位系统获取 其定位信息。定位系统可以是GPS (Globle Position Service,全球卫星定位系统)系统 或北斗卫星定位系统等。由于使用导航装置的用户可能处于移动状态,因此需要对定位信 息进行跟踪获取。
[0031] 步骤S108,根据目标位置、定位信息以及地图信息生成导航信息。
[0032] 在一个实施例中,可通过导航地图匹配算法生成导航信息,生成的导航信息可以 是地理位置序列。例如,导航信息可由获取到的定位信息作为起始,并包含依次经过的路 口,最终以目标位置作为终点。其中路口的位置信息还包括转向信息。
[0033] 步骤S110,通过语音播报导航信息。
[0034] 在一个实施例中,可定期通过语音播报导航信息。即每隔一段时间即播报导航信 肩、。
[0035] 在一个实施例中,还可根据跟踪获取到的定位信息进行播报。例如,可在定位信息 和导航信息中与该定位信息最接近的路口位置之间的距离分别为1〇〇米、50米时进行播报 该路口位置,并播报该路口位置对应的转向信息,从而提示用户提前准备转向,使用户不会 因为车速太快来不及转向而行驶到错误的路线上。
[0036] 在本实施例中,还可获取电子地图,并在电子地图上展示导航信息。使得当用户未 听清语音播报时,仍可通过显示界面查看导航信息。
[0037] 电子地图可以是离线地图也可以是实时下载的卫星图像。优选的,电子地图还可 以是3D地图或街景地图。3D地图或街景地图更接近用户实际所处的环境,从而能使用户快 速地对自己所处的位置以及导航信息有所了解。
[0038] 在一个实施例中,还可根据导航信息获取实时路况信息、红绿灯状态信息和/或 驾驶参数信息,通过语音播报实时路况信息、红绿灯状态信息和/或驾驶参数信息。
[0039] 实时路况信息即实时的道路维修状况、车辆拥塞状况和路面情况等。道路维修状 况即某条路线是否处于维修施工状态中而不能通行,车辆拥塞状况即某条路线上是否存在 堵车状况以及已经堵车的时间长度,路面状况即由于天气或其他因素而导致的路面受损状 况。
[0040] 红绿灯状态信息即与导航信息中的路口位置对应的红绿灯的状况,可包括当前红 绿灯的个数、状态以及各自的当前红灯持续时间。
[0041] 在使用离线地图的应用场景中,由于离线地图上不会包含上述实时的信息,从而 使用户能够更加准确地选择路线。
[0042] 在本实施例中,实时路况信息及红绿灯状态信息可存储在服务器上。可从服务器 下载或接收服务器的实时推送得到实时路况信息。
[0043] 驾驶参数信息可包括行驶速度、预计到达时间等。可根据跟踪获取到的定位信息 以及跟踪的时长计算得到驾驶参数信息。
[0044] 进一步的,还可根据实时路况信息、红绿灯状态信息和/或驾驶参数信息修改导 航信息。
[0045] 例如,可根据实时路况信息、红绿灯状态信息和/或驾驶参数信息排除掉路况较 差或红绿灯较多的路线,从而修改导航信息。优选的,可语音提示用户是否进行修改,若是, 则进行修改,若否,则维持原导航信息。
[0046] 在一个实施例中,还可根据地图信息获取与定位信息对应的兴趣点信息,通过语 音播报兴趣点信息。
[0047] 若用户处于移动状态,则跟踪获取到的定位信息会发生变化,当获取跟踪获取到 的定位信息附近的兴趣点信息,并语音通报。例如,若用户处于驾驶状态时,可语音播报其 途径的餐馆、超市、写字楼和商场等兴趣点。使得用户在驾驶过程中,不需要对周边的设施 进行过分关注,从而可专注于驾驶操作上,提高安全性。
[0048] 在一个实施例中,如图2所示,一种导航装置,包括:关键字获取模块102、目标位 置获取模块104、跟踪定位模块106、导航信息生成模块108以及语音播报模块110,其中:
[0049] 关键字获取模块102,用于获取输入的关键字。
[0050] 目标位置获取模块104,用于获取地图信息,根据关键字和地图信息获取目标位 置。
[0051] 在一个实施例中,关键字获取模块102可用于获取文本输入框中输入的关键字, 目标位置获取模块104可用于在获取到的地图信息中进行搜索,查找与关键字对应的兴趣 点名称,并获取兴趣点名称的位置信息作为目标位置。在导航【技术领域】中,兴趣点即电子地 图上标记餐饮、公交、地铁、写字楼、商场等实体设施的标识。例如,若用户输入的关键字为 "腾讯",则与之相应的兴趣点名称可以是"腾讯大厦",其对应的位置信息即为腾讯公司办 公楼所在的具体位置。在本实施例中,若与关键字对应的兴趣点名称有多个,可将与关键字 对应的多个兴趣点以列表的形式展示,并获取输入的兴趣点选取请求,获取兴趣点选取请 求对应的兴趣点名称。
[0052] 在一个实施例中,关键字获取模块102还可用于获取输入的音频片段,对音频片 段进行语音识别得到关键字。
[0053] 在本实施例中,用户可通过话筒口述其希望到达的目的地的名称。在获取到该用 户口述的音频片段后,对其进行音频识别,得到对应的字符串,并将其作为关键字在地图信 息中进行查找,得到对应的兴趣点名称,并获取其对应的位置信息。若查找到的兴趣点名称 有多个,可通过语音播报该多个兴趣点名称,并获取用户口述的选择指令,通过对该选择指 令进行语音识别,得到用户选取的兴趣点名称,从而获取到兴趣点名称对应的位置信息作 为目标位置。
[0054] 跟踪定位模块106,用于跟踪定位信息。
[0055] 定位信息即使用导航装置的用户实际所在的地理位置信息。可通过定位系统获取 其定位信息。定位系统可以是GPS (Globle Position Service,全球卫星定位系统)系统 或北斗卫星定位系统等。由于使用导航装置的用户可能处于移动状态,因此需要对定位信 息进行跟踪获取。
[0056] 导航信息生成模块108,用于根据目标位置、定位信息以及地图信息生成导航信 肩、。
[0057] 在一个实施例中,可通过导航地图匹配算法生成导航信息,生成的导航信息可以 是地理位置序列。例如,导航信息可由获取到的定位信息作为起始,并包含依次经过的路 口,最终以目标位置作为终点。其中路口的位置信息还包括转向信息。
[0058] 语音播报模块110,用于通过语音播报导航信息。
[0059] 在一个实施例中,语音播报模块110可用于定期通过语音播报导航信息。即每隔 一段时间即播报导航信息。
[0060] 在一个实施例中,语音播报模块110还可用于根据跟踪获取到的定位信息进行播 报。例如,可在定位信息和导航信息中与该定位信息最接近的路口位置之间的距离分别为 100米、50米时进行播报该路口位置,并播报该路口位置对应的转向信息,从而提示用户提 前准备转向,使用户不会因为车速太快来不及转向而行驶到错误的路线上。
[0061] 在本实施例中,还可获取电子地图,并在电子地图上展示导航信息。使得当用户未 听清语音播报时,仍可通过显示界面查看导航信息。
[0062] 电子地图可以是离线地图也可以是实时下载的卫星图像。优选的,电子地图还可 以是3D地图或街景地图。3D地图或街景地图更接近用户实际所处的环境,从而能使用户快 速地对自己所处的位置以及导航信息有所了解。
[0063] 在一个实施例中,如图3所示,导航装置还包括实时交通信息通知模块112,用于 根据导航信息获取实时路况信息、红绿灯状态信息和/或驾驶参数信息,通过语音播报实 时路况信息、红绿灯状态信息和/或驾驶参数信息。
[0064] 实时路况信息即实时的道路维修状况、车辆拥塞状况和路面情况等。道路维修状 况即某条路线是否处于维修施工状态中而不能通行,车辆拥塞状况即某条路线上是否存在 堵车状况以及已经堵车的时间长度,路面状况即由于天气或其他因素而导致的路面受损状 况。
[0065] 红绿灯状态信息即与导航信息中的路口位置对应的红绿灯的状况,可包括当前红 绿灯的个数、状态以及各自的当前红灯持续时间。
[0066] 在使用离线地图的应用场景中,由于离线地图上不会包含上述实时的信息,从而 使用户能够更加准确地选择路线。
[0067] 在本实施例中,实时路况信息及红绿灯状态信息可存储在服务器上。可从服务器 下载或接收服务器的实时推送得到实时路况信息。
[0068] 驾驶参数信息可包括行驶速度、预计到达时间等。可根据跟踪获取到的定位信息 以及跟踪的时长计算得到驾驶参数信息。
[0069] 进一步的,导航信息生成模块108还可用于根据实时路况信息、红绿灯状态信息 和/或驾驶参数信息修改导航信息。
[0070] 例如,可根据实时路况信息、红绿灯状态信息和/或驾驶参数信息排除掉路况较 差或红绿灯较多的路线,从而修改导航信息。优选的,可语音提示用户是否进行修改,若是, 则进行修改,若否,则维持原导航信息。
[0071] 在一个实施例中,如图3所示,导航装置还包括兴趣点通知模块114,用于根据地 图信息获取与定位信息对应的兴趣点信息,通过语音播报兴趣点信息。
[0072] 若用户处于移动状态,则跟踪获取到的定位信息会发生变化,当获取跟踪获取到 的定位信息附近的兴趣点信息,并语音通报。例如,若用户处于驾驶状态时,可语音播报其 途径的餐馆、超市、写字楼和商场等兴趣点。使得用户在驾驶过程中,不需要对周边的设施 进行过分关注,从而可专注于驾驶操作上,提高安全性。
[0073] 上述导航方法及装置,通过语音播报导航信息,使得用户在驾驶时无需专注于显 示屏上的行驶路线,而将注意力放在驾驶视野上,从而避免了因驾驶者注意力不集中导致 的车祸,提高了安全性。
[0074] 本领域普通技术人员可以理解实现上述实施例方法中的全部或部分流程,是可以 通过计算机程序来指令相关的硬件来完成,所述的程序可存储于一计算机可读取存储介质 中,该程序在执行时,可包括如上述各方法的实施例的流程。其中,所述的存储介质可为磁 碟、光盘、只读存储记忆体(Read-Only Memory, ROM)或随机存储记忆体(Random Access Memory,RAM)等。
[0075] 以上所述实施例仅表达了本发明的几种实施方式,其描述较为具体和详细,但并 不能因此而理解为对本发明专利范围的限制。应当指出的是,对于本领域的普通技术人员 来说,在不脱离本发明构思的前提下,还可以做出若干变形和改进,这些都属于本发明的保 护范围。因此,本发明专利的保护范围应以所附权利要求为准。
【权利要求】
1. 一种导航方法,包括: 获取输入的关键字; 获取地图信息,根据所述关键字和所述地图信息获取目标位置; 跟踪获取定位信息; 根据所述目标位置、定位信息以及所述地图信息生成导航信息; 通过语音播报所述导航信息。
2. 根据权利要求1所述的导航方法,其特征在于,所述获取输入的关键字的步骤包括: 获取输入的音频片段; 对所述音频片段进行语音识别得到关键字。
3. 根据权利要求1所述的导航方法,其特征在于,所述方法还包括: 根据所述导航信息获取实时路况信息、红绿灯状态信息和/或驾驶参数信息; 通过语音播报所述实时路况信息、红绿灯状态信息和/或驾驶参数信息。
4. 根据权利要求3所述的导航方法,其特征在于,所述根据导航信息获取实时路况信 息、红绿灯状态信息和/或驾驶参数信息的步骤之后还包括: 根据所述实时路况信息、红绿灯状态信息和/或驾驶参数信息修改所述导航信息。
5. 根据权利要求3所述的导航方法,其特征在于,所述获取定位信息的步骤之后还包 括: 根据所述地图信息获取与所述定位信息对应的兴趣点信息; 通过语音播报所述兴趣点信息。
6. -种导航装置,其特征在于,包括: 关键字获取模块,用于获取输入的关键字; 目标位置获取模块,用于获取地图信息,根据所述关键字和所述地图信息获取目标位 置; 跟踪定位模块,用于跟踪获取定位信息; 导航信息生成模块,用于根据所述目标位置、定位信息以及所述地图信息生成导航信 息; 语音播报模块,用于通过语音播报所述导航信息。
7. 根据权利要求6所述的导航装置,其特征在于,所述关键字获取模块还用于获取输 入的音频片段,对所述音频片段进行语音识别得到关键字。
8. 根据权利要求6所述的导航装置,其特征在于,所述装置还包括实时交通信息通知 模块,用于根据所述导航信息获取实时路况信息、红绿灯状态信息和/或驾驶参数信息,通 过语音播报所述实时路况信息、红绿灯状态信息和/或驾驶参数信息。
9. 根据权利要求8所述的导航装置,其特征在于,所述导航信息生成模块还用于根据 所述实时路况信息、红绿灯状态信息和/或驾驶参数信息修改所述导航信息。
10. 根据权利要求6所述的导航装置,其特征在于,所述兴趣点通知模块,用于根据所 述地图信息获取与所述定位信息对应的兴趣点信息,通过语音播报所述兴趣点信息。
【文档编号】G01C21/36GK104154926SQ201310177635
【公开日】2014年11月19日 申请日期:2013年5月14日 优先权日:2013年5月14日
【发明者】叶颖华, 侯月姣 申请人:腾讯科技(深圳)有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1